DescriptionPhotograph, Black and white; Horizontal image of a Kaman UH-2B Sea Sprite helicopter on the flight deck. Two men stand next to the open cockpit door. One man is behind the tail of the helicopter and another inspects the proper left landing gear. The four men appear to have light to medium skin tone. Markings on Sea Sprite include “HU” on rudder, “USS Intrepid // 149766 // Navy // HC-2 9766” and the U.S. national insignia on tail boom, Fleet Angels medallion on cockpit door, “27” on side of nose and above cockpit window, and “Do Not Push” printed twice on nose. One man near cockpit door is wearing long sleeves and a snap-button vest. The second man near the cockpit door, Wayne F. Stiles, is wearing a flight vest and dismounting the helicopter. A helmet with a white star on top is visible through the cockpit window.The back has " USS Intrepid (CVA-11) // WESTPAC Cruise // (Helo side # matches log book entries) // Helicopter "dismount" // Lt Wayne F. Stiles - HC-2 // unknown HC-2 crewman" written in black ink.
